A Piece of Cake

Choosing the right cake for your wedding reception can be anything but a piece of cake.  Even if you already have your perfect flavor in mind, a Wedding Baker can introduce you to more tasty flavors than you ever heard of in your life...not to mention the different fillings available and flavor of the icing!  To top it all of, each tier can be a different flavor!!!

Once you have your chosen the flavor(s) picked, the hard part begins - the design.  Remember, your wedding cake will be on display at your wedding reception.  Your guest will flock to it during the cocktail hour to take in it's beauty and artistry.  Your cake will again have all eyes on it when the fun cake cutting ceremony begins.

Cake designs vary greatly.  Choose one that reflects your personality and the theme and size of your wedding. Here are a few examples of what a wonderful Wedding Cake Designer can do:
